About Cambodia

There is archaeological evidence to show that people have been in Cambodia since 4,000 BC. By the 1st century BC, Chinese traders were reporting on its existence. The Chinese called the area Funaan, the Khmer kingdom. Much later, Cambodia became a French colony.

The country has a tragic recent history. Over 2 million people died of torture, starvation, disease and execution under the rule of Pol Pot.

Cambodian culture has its roots firmly in Hindu and Buddhist traditions. Cambodians are respectful and polite, greeting each other with the 'Sampeah'. This is a bow, accompanied by the palms of the hands placed together. If someone greets you in this way, you should respond in the same manner.

The cuisine is simple, with rice being a staple. Fish, beef and pork curries are eaten with rice or noodles and Coconut milk. Durian is a popular fruit in Cambodia. Try it—it's very different to western fruits!

What to do in Cambodia

The most famous place to visit in Cambodia, and the most impressive, is Angkor—a UNESCO World Heritage site, and home to Angkor Wat, one of the world’s most iconic temples. It’s a must-see site when on holiday in the country.

Visit the markets and experience the smells from the street food being cooked around you. This Cambodian takeaway food is well worth trying!

Visit memorable Phnom Penh, the capital city, on the Mekong Delta. Take a boat trip along the Mekong River and let your imagination fly. Go to the art deco Central Market, there and enjoy the sights and sounds.

Sample dishes containing the Kampot pepper - native to Cambodia. If you visit Kampot, be sure to go to the Preah Monivong National Park (also known as the Phnom Bokor National Park). Look out for the Durian roundabout with a statue of the popular fruit on it.

There are many sites in Cambodia that are worth visiting, but go before it gets too popular.

Top travel tips for Cambodia

Now that the roads in Cambodia have improved, travelling from A to B by bus is a good travel option. Most bus services begin and end in Phnom Penh. Some smaller villages are not on bus routes, or have limited services.

Minibusses can be used for local trips. So can tuk-tuks - a motorbike in front with a passenger bench behind. These are cheap, but it's a good idea to agree the fare before getting in. Motorbike taxis (motos) can also be found in cities.

If you are in Phnom Penh, organised tours can be booked at travel agents.

If you want to see what Thailand was like twenty years or so ago, visit Cambodia. It is much less developed than its neighbours. It's a cheap tourist destination that is becoming more and more popular. Sample the delicious food and see the sites. Old Khmer Wooden House 2Beds & Breakfast
Everything good about visiting Cambodia summed up in one house.

A lovely family run house which is located in a little alleyway in the middle of Siem Reap. We were picked up from the airport by Santana in a tuk tuk and driven directly there which made the transfer even more simple. We were greeted by our hosts Tin Sy and his lovely wife and child. The House is on the first floor and consists of a balcony, living room, bedroom, dressing room and bathroom. it is clean and comfortable and we felt right at home from the minute we took off our shoes and walked up the stairs; nothing was too much trouble, we needed some laundry done as we had been travelling for over a fortnight previously and we wanted to visit the floating village and flooded forests along with the temple complexes of Angkor Wat, Angkor Thom and some 20 others which we had read about in advance. Santana looked after us for the next 3 days and we saw everything on our itinerary and loads more besides as he is local and was able to take us to smaller gems away from the throngs of tourists which also enhanced the experience. there was a lovely breakfast on the balcony each morning and plenty of cold water and beer in the cold box. We had a wonderful evening meal with some beef Lok Lak and a roasted fish which melted in the mouth. if you are an independent traveller who does not want to stay in an anonymous hotel and would like to experience a little piece of Cambodian life then this is the place for you.
